AI Analysis

Surface-level numbers suggest a competitive matchup, but the Strength of Schedule correction tells a different story. The favorite has earned their metrics against stiffer competition, exposing a meaningful performance gap between these two sides.

Both teams have faced similar levels of opposition (SoS: 46.9 vs 47.7), making the raw statistics a reliable comparison tool in this matchup.

Lens holds the attacking edge with 2.5 goals per match versus Sochaux's 1.8, though the gap isn't insurmountable.

Lens has the defensive edge, conceding 1.3 per match compared to Sochaux's 1.8.

Sochaux has not faced any elite-level opponents in their recent matches, making it difficult to assess their ceiling.

Sochaux is a strong road performer with a 67% away win rate, proving they can deliver results regardless of venue.

Crunching the numbers, this match averages out to 3.7 total goals. Going Over 2.5 carries the stronger statistical case, with the BTTS market looking likely given current form.

📈 Form Momentum: Lens has been remarkably consistent, maintaining a steady 2.1 points per game over their last 10 matches. This stability makes them a predictable but reliable force.

📊 Key Trend: The form trajectories are diverging. Lens is on the rise with 6W in last 10, while Sochaux shows signs of decline with 3W in last 5.

⚠️ Risk Factor: Despite being the statistical favorite, Lens faces a key vulnerability: their away form is significantly weaker than their home record. If Sochaux can exploit this, an upset becomes plausible.

💡 Why This Matters: The 15.1-point power rating gap between these teams translates to approximately a 85% win probability for Lens. In practical terms, Lens would win 8 out of 10 such matchups.

The numbers point firmly toward Lens in this contest. Their superior power rating of 65.0, compared to 49.9 for the opposition, reflects a meaningful edge across the metrics that matter most when projecting an outcome.

In their recent Coupe de France match (2026-01-11), Lens prevailed 0-3 against Sochaux. This result provides valuable insight into how these teams match up against each other. Notably, Lens achieved this result away from home, which is particularly impressive. Winning on the road against Sochaux shows genuine quality and mental strength. The 0-3 scoreline was emphatic — Lens completely dominated Sochaux in that encounter, raising serious questions about Sochaux's ability to compete at this level.
